When it comes to the Three Kings, there are three well-known names that are often associated with them: Balthazar, Melchior, and Caspar. These three individuals are said to have visited the baby Jesus after his birth, bringing with them gifts of gold, frankincense, and myrrh. However, one of the names mentioned in the question was not one of the Three Kings, and that is Solomon.

Solomon is a biblical figure who is known for his wisdom and wealth. He was the son of King David and Bathsheba and became the king of Israel after his father's death. Although he is a significant figure in biblical history, he is not commonly associated with the Three Kings who visited Jesus.

On the other hand, Balthazar, Melchior, and Caspar have become synonymous with the Three Kings in Christian tradition. Each of these names is associated with a specific gift presented to Jesus. Balthazar is often depicted as the king who brought the gift of myrrh, Melchior as the king who brought frankincense, and Caspar as the king who brought gold.

This story of the Three Kings is an important part of the Christmas narrative and is often reenacted in nativity plays and displays. The gifts they brought symbolize their recognition of Jesus' divinity and their homage to him as a king.

It is interesting to note that the names Balthazar, Melchior, and Caspar are not mentioned in the Bible. Instead, they are believed to have been added to the story later on, possibly to fulfill the prophecy of Isaiah 60:6, which states, "They shall bring gold and frankincense, and shall proclaim the praise of the Lord."

In conclusion, Solomon was not one of the Three Kings who visited Jesus. The Three Kings are traditionally known as Balthazar, Melchior, and Caspar. These individuals played a significant role in the Christmas story, bringing gifts to the baby Jesus and symbolizing the recognition of his divinity.
